Dated at the City of Regina, in the Province of Saskatchewan, this 3rd day of May 2025. NOTICE OF
INTENTION TO CONSIDER LONG-TERM DEBT FINANCING FOR THE WATER NETWORK EXPANSION PROJECT (previously
known as the Eastern Pressure Solution Project) AND UNFUNDED DEVELOPMENT CHARGES FEE PROJECTS The
City of Regina hereby gives notice, pursuant to sections 101 and 102 of The Cities Act and The
Public Notice Policy Bylaw, Bylaw No. 2020-28, of its intention to consider a report on long-term
debt financing to fund the Water Network Expansion Project (previously known as the Eastern
Pressure Solution Project) and Development Charges Fee projects.
